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$2,796 per month in Solothurn vs $1,368 in Ubud, Bali, rent included.

A couple spends around $4,518 per month in Solothurn vs $2,348 in Ubud, Bali, rent included.

A family of three spends $6,239 per month in Solothurn vs $3,327 in Ubud, Bali, rent included.

Solothurn costs about 104% more than Ubud, Bali, driven mainly by Eating Out.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$1,163 in Solothurn versus $1,115 in Ubud, Bali.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 4087% higher in Solothurn,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$144 in Solothurn versus $36.00 in Ubud, Bali.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$626 vs $295 – making Ubud, Bali the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
